Boba Fett's Original Role in Star Wars: Return of the Jedi Revealed

HaydnSpurrell HaydnSpurrell To this day, despite his unceremonious culling early on in Return of the Jedi, Boba Fett remains a fan-favourite character from the original trilogy. But things may have worked out very differently for the character, making his sudden departure make a whole lot more sense.

George Lucas had intended for a third trilogy that would detail Luke and Darth Vader's confrontation, as well as the battle with the Empire. An entire trilogy was designed, but in the end it was squashed down into one film.

The third film initially, then, would have had Boba Fett rescuing Han Solo, with Fett playing the main villain of the film, following his introduction in The Empire Strikes Back. So the third film would have explored things such as, 'why was he taking Han Solo away in the first place?' In the end, Lucas threw away that angle, and so we're left with a gobbled-up Boba Fett in the opening ten minutes.
